After yesterday, today was going to be easier. Which it was but the addition of rain, a little hail and colder temps made it memorable. We left from John Day at 7:20 and only went 8 miles for breakfast at the Silver Spur in Mt. Vernon. I had enough coffee for everyone. Breakfast was great. The temp was only 41 when we headed out to Dayville only 20 miles down the road.
Unfortunately Twisted Treasures restaurant that features gun-packing cook and waitress was not open. The Dayville Cafe came through with pie. We ordered sandwiches to go and also got a candy bar at the Dayville Merchantile.
Thus began our one climb of the day. The elevation gain was 2736 over 35 miles of slightly uphill and more uphill. The rain and hail came periodically. We put our rain jackets and took our rain jackets many times. The temperature at the top was 45. Luckily a 7-mile smooth downhill made our day on a great note. We are snug inside at the Mitchell Spoke-n-hostel. I have had two cups of hot tea to warm up. Tim is eyeing ice cream in the freezer and Eric is wandering the whole place that is full of books, maps, pictures and bunk beds. We are doing great now.
